Upper Sandusky, OH – Antler King’s Southern Greens creates thriving food plots not only for properties south of the Mason-Dixon but also in the frigid North, thanks to an all-season drought- and cold-tolerant blend.
The mix includes collard greens, radishes, winter wheat, and oats for palatable food plots that produce from the early archery season through late firearm seasons. Big brassica leaves produce tonnage and provide high amounts of protein and calcium early in the season with low tannin levels, and the plants turn into a sweet, high-energy food source after the first frost.
Fast-growing winter wheat and oat varieties are palatable from the moment they emerge well past hunting seasons, and clover sprouts up in the spring as well to provide the protein necessary for adding body mass and carrying fawns.
As a constant food source, Southern Greens offers the energy every herd needs and generates a continuous flow of traffic in your food plots all season long.
An 8-pound bag of Southern Greens plants ¼ acre and retails for $24.99.
